2016-10-12 6 views
5

У меня есть вопрос для списка тасов в scala, используя scala.util.Random.Перемешать список в Scala

Например, у меня есть

val a = cyan 
val b = magenta 
val c = yellow 
val d = key 

val color = Random.shuffle.List(a,b,c,d).toString //but it doesn't work ;(

поэтому я хочу val color быть произвольный порядок val a, b, c and d.

+2

Вы задали в основном один и тот же вопрос три раза в настоящее время. Вы не получаете ответы, которые вам нужны? (http://stackoverflow.com/questions/39989771/scala-random-list-of-val-order, http://stackoverflow.com/questions/39981539/scala-random-string) –

ответ

31

пользователя в Scala Случайный метод класса перетасовать:

scala.util.Random.shuffle(List(a,b,c,d)) 
Смежные вопросы